How do I stop nest camera from recording?
Camera settings
- Open the Nest app .
- On the home screen, select your camera.
- Tap Settings .
- Tap the switch next to Camera On/Off.

How do you record a Nest video?
Create a video clip
- Go to home.nest.com and sign in.
- Select the camera that recorded the video you want to use.
- Select Clips in the lower right corner of the screen.
- Choose Create clip.
- Sliders will appear on your timeline.
- Name for your new clip and choose Save.
- A popup will appear that says Your clip is ready.

How do you know if someone is watching your nest cam?
Look for the light.
Nest Cam is on. Connecting to Wi-Fi. Blinking green means that someone’s watching. Blinking blue means that someone’s talking through the speaker.

Do I have to buy Nest Aware for each camera?
Do You Need a Nest Aware Subscription for Each Camera? You do not need a subscription for each device you own. Either subscription plan will cover all your Nest devices, including video doorbells, smart displays, and speakers.

Does Nest call the police?
If your Nest Secure alarm sounds and it isn’t quickly silenced, an agent from your professional monitoring service will call you.When anyone verifies the alarm as real, or if no one responds to the agent’s calls, the agent will notify the local police precinct and inform them about the alarm and your home’s location.
